Description

Church View is an 18th-century house located on the east side of Evercreech. The house is constructed of rubble with raised alternating freestone quoins, and has a double-Roman tiled roof with coped verges and a small brick stack. It is two-storeyed and has a symmetrical three-bay frontage. The windows are late 20th-century aluminium casements set in moulded freestone surrounds. The central door is within a moulded stone surround, featuring a half-glazed door, scrollwork stone brackets, and a shallow stone head.
